Abram is a boy’s name of Hebrew origin. Meaning “high father,” “father of nations,” or “the father is exalted,” Abram is a timeless classic, renowned for its connection to the biblical forebear in the Book of Genesis in the Hebrew Bible. Parents looking for a baby name with religious significance or a long history will find Abram is up to the challenge. Many other variations exist and continue to pop up, such as Abraham, Abe, and Bram, giving this title a new lease of life and securing its future for a few more centuries.
